Daylight hours refer to the period between sunrise and sunset. This duration changes throughout the year based on season and geographic location.
Earth's 23.5° axial tilt causes uneven sunlight distribution. Your hemisphere receives less direct sunlight in winter (shorter days) and more in summer (longer days).
Northern Hemisphere: June 20-22 (summer solstice).
Southern Hemisphere: December 21-23.
Near polar circles, the sun doesn't set for 24 hours.
Northern Hemisphere: December 21-22 (winter solstice).
Southern Hemisphere: June 20-21.

Most rapid change near equinoxes: 2-4 minutes daily.
Slowest change near solstices: <1 minute daily.
